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2787561 0316 5312
15057102 80933085257 25163500
15057102 80933085257 25163500
444085251 746 979972
All about undefined
Interested in learning more?
15057102 80933085257 25163500
444085251 746 979972
See more
1541847 16408426905 8146
588682 6354052169 13703361986
See more
9310353410 7721757 11870959847
783523 469558810 57
See more